When it pertains to window treatments, there are a number of variables to take into consideration in between drapes vs. curtains, shades, and blinds. Some individuals use these look at this site terms mutually, particularly drapes and curtains. Nevertheless, while all 4 window therapy options can be made use of with numerous embellishing styles and spaces, each has distinct qualities. Below are the similarities and differences between drapes, drapes, tones, and blinds to assist you make the appropriate selection for your demands. You'll locate curtains in a wide variety of sizes, sizes, fabrics, shades, and patterns. They are best for any type of kind of room, including the living-room, as they are optimal for gliding glass
doors. Drapes can soften a space, along with add color and appearance. Drapes hang from a rod, which can be ordinary or ornamental. Others have steel grommets or fabric tabs stitched at the top to slide over the pole. Rings or hooks can clip to the top of drapes to affix them to the rod. Some curtains are referred to as sheers since the material provides marginal light blocking and personal privacy, and large drapes that cover just the bottom half of a window are called caf drapes. Like drapes, the purpose of drapes is to use personal privacy and add visual interest to an area. The visible fabric of drapes is usually heavy and rather tight, with typical materials includingvelvet, damask, and silk. Drapery panels are commonly sold in pairs as window treatments. Similar to drapes, drapes hang from a rod on rings, hooks, grommets, or using a material sleeve. The heaviness of drapes can forecast a formal feel, as the top of a drape panel is typically pleated. Occasionally called draperies, these home window treatments are typically long enough to reach from somewhat above the home window to the flooring. They can even puddle a little bit on the floor. However, no guideline says that drapes have to touch the flooring; that's a personal style choice. They are best for any kind of kind of space. Tones are connected to a rod or framework and are sized to fit within the home window frameunlike drapes or curtains, which hang listed below the sill. To allow in light and see outside, you require to elevate the color using either a cord, roller, or raising system. Basic roller tones are inexpensive, and as the name suggests, the product rolls around a pole on top. Various other prominent kinds of shades consist of Roman shades, which pull up into deep pleats; balloon shades, which pouf into balloons of fabric; and tie-up tones, whichattach making use of a material connection to hold them open. Unlike shades, you do not have to totally increase callous translucent them; you can just turn them open up. Common midsts for blind slats are 1/2 inch, 1 inch, or 2 inchesthe latter of which are often called Venetian blinds. The length and size of the blinds are sized to fit within the home window frame. These are typically made use of on gliding patio area doors or over big moving home windows. When it pertains to blinds, some light might leak through the fractures between slats and around the sides. Still, blinds are appropriate for rooms. And you can top them with curtains to additionally obstruct light.
